Achieving a top nuclear medicine technologist salary in Torrance, California, can be exceptionally rewarding for seasoned professionals in the field. With a 2026 median annual salary projected at $179,309, experienced technologists can aim for earnings reaching as high as $250,147 at the 90th percentile, showcasing the potential for significant financial advancement driven by specialized skills and extensive experience. This remarkable earning potential not only surpasses the national median salary of $106,398 by an impressive 68.53%, but also reflects a consistent upward trajectory within the profession. Attaining these top-tier salaries typically requires over seven years of experience, advanced certifications, and a reputation for excellence in high-demand specializations such as PET/CT, which is particularly lucrative in the Torrance market.

Maximizing Your Nuclear Medicine Technologist Earnings in Torrance

Factors influencing senior nuclear medicine technologist pay in CA include specialized knowledge and employer type, with certain disciplines commanding notable premiums. Technologists specializing in PET/CT, especially those focusing on oncology, nuclear cardiology, and theranostics techniques such as Lutathera and Pluvicto, are increasingly valued, as these are the fastest-growing areas within the field. Compensation structures vary significantly across different employment settings; professionals in hospital nuclear medicine departments or advanced outpatient PET/CT imaging centers generally enjoy higher salaries compared to those in traditional or SPECT-only roles. Furthermore, leadership opportunities, like becoming a PET/CT supervisor or a radiation safety officer, can further enhance one’s earning potential. Achieving these roles often requires obtaining meaningful credentials, such as an Associate's or Bachelor's degree from a JRCNMT-accredited program and meeting the requirements for NMTCB or ARRT(N) national certification. Additionally, gaining training in CT cross-sectioned imaging can add to one’s marketability, leading to enhanced salary negotiations and non-monetary benefits in this competitive landscape.
